Overview
Merge PACS
Merge PACS helps you manage medical images and diagnostic data through a single, unified viewer. You can access images from various modalities and departments, allowing you to read studies from anywhere with an internet connection. The platform eliminates the need for multiple workstations by consolidating your imaging workflow into one streamlined interface.
By using this software, you reduce the manual effort required to manage patient records and imaging studies. It integrates directly with your existing EHR and RIS systems to ensure patient data remains synchronized. Whether you are a radiologist in a high-volume hospital or a specialist in a private clinic, you can customize the viewing experience to match your specific diagnostic needs.
UltraLinq
UltraLinq provides you with a centralized, cloud-based platform to manage your medical imaging and diagnostic data. Instead of relying on physical servers or localized workstations, you can upload exams directly from your modalities to a secure environment. This allows you to view, perform measurements, and generate professional clinical reports from any location with an internet connection. It streamlines your entire diagnostic workflow by consolidating images and data into a single, accessible archive.
The platform is designed for diverse clinical environments, including private practices, mobile imaging providers, and multi-site hospital systems. You can easily share exams with referring physicians or specialists for consultations without burning CDs or mailing films. By moving your imaging workflow to the cloud, you reduce IT overhead while ensuring your patient data remains protected and compliant with healthcare regulations.

Merge PACS Features
- Zero-Footprint Viewer Access and view diagnostic-quality images from any web browser without installing heavy software on your local computer.
- Intelligent Prefetching Save time by automatically loading relevant prior studies so you have the full patient history ready before you start reading.
- Customizable Hanging Protocols Set up your preferred image layouts once and have them apply automatically every time you open a new study.
- Multi-Modality Support View images from MRI, CT, PET, and ultrasound within a single interface to simplify your diagnostic process.
- EHR Integration Launch imaging studies directly from your patient's electronic health record to maintain a continuous clinical workflow.
- Advanced Reporting Tools Create and sign off on diagnostic reports quickly using integrated voice recognition and structured reporting templates.
UltraLinq Features
- Cloud-Based Viewer. Access and interpret your diagnostic images from any web browser without installing specialized software on your local computer.
- Clinical Reporting. Create professional, customized clinical reports using built-in templates that automatically pull in your measurements and patient data.
- Automated Archiving. Store your exams securely in the cloud with automated backups that ensure you meet long-term medical record retention requirements.
- Measurement Tools. Perform precise calculations and annotations directly on your images using a comprehensive set of digital measurement tools.
- Physician Portals. Share exam results instantly with referring physicians through a secure portal, eliminating the need for physical media like CDs.
- Multi-Modality Support. Consolidate images from ultrasound, ECG, and other diagnostic modalities into one unified patient record for easier review.

Pros & Cons
Merge PACS
Pros
- Reliable performance even when handling large imaging datasets
- Highly customizable interface fits various physician preferences
- Strong integration capabilities with existing hospital systems
- Web-based access enables flexible remote reading options
Cons
- Initial configuration requires significant technical expertise
- Learning curve for mastering advanced diagnostic tools
- Customer support response times can be inconsistent
UltraLinq
Pros
- Access your clinical data from any location easily
- Eliminates the need for expensive on-site server maintenance
- Streamlines the reporting process with automated data entry
- Simplifies sharing images with outside referring physicians
- Reliable customer support for technical implementation needs
Cons
- Requires a stable internet connection for image viewing
- Initial configuration of modality routing can be complex
- Interface feels dated compared to modern consumer software
